1. Scuba diving in Goa

Explore the underwater wonders of the Arabian Sea with scuba diving in Goa, India's premier coastal destination known for its pristine beaches and vibrant marine life. Whether you're a beginner or an experienced diver, Goa offers a range of diving sites suitable for all levels, each providing a unique glimpse into the colorful world beneath the waves.

The clear, warm waters of Goa make it an ideal location for scuba diving year-round. Popular dive sites such as Grande Island, Bat Island, and Suzy's Wreck teem with diverse marine species, including colorful corals, tropical fish, rays, turtles, and occasional encounters with reef sharks. Experienced dive operators in Goa ensure safe and memorable underwater experiences, guiding divers through underwater landscapes that range from vibrant coral gardens to underwater cliffs and shipwrecks.

Scuba diving in Goa is not just about exploring marine life; it's also an opportunity to witness historical shipwrecks, vibrant coral formations, and underwater caves that add excitement and intrigue to each dive. 4. Hiking in Munnar

Embark on a captivating hiking adventure in Munnar, India, a charming hill station in the lush greenery of Kerala's Western Ghats. Hiking in Munnar offers a delightful opportunity to explore the scenic beauty of tea plantations, misty mountains, and cascading waterfalls that characterize this serene destination.

Trails in Munnar cater to various hiking enthusiasts, from leisurely walks through tea estates to challenging treks up the rolling hills and picturesque valleys. Popular routes include the Anamudi Peak trek, where adventurers can scale South India's highest peak for panoramic views of the Western Ghats, and the picturesque Attukal Waterfalls trail, leading hikers through a verdant landscape dotted with scenic waterfalls.

The hiking trails in Munnar are a treat for nature lovers, offering encounters with diverse flora and fauna, including exotic bird species, lush forests, and vibrant blossoms. 5. Kayaking in Kerala backwaters

Embark on a serene and immersive adventure by kayaking in the backwaters of Kerala, India, where you can explore the tranquil network of waterways, rivers, and lagoons that crisscross the lush landscapes of God's Own Country. Kayaking in Kerala's backwaters offers a unique opportunity to experience the region's rich biodiversity, traditional village life, and picturesque scenery from the perspective of a quiet and eco-friendly mode of transportation.

As you glide through the calm waters in your kayak, you'll be surrounded by verdant coconut groves, swaying palm trees, vibrant birdlife, and the rhythmic sights and sounds of everyday life along the backwaters. Expert local guides will lead you through narrow canals and open lagoons, sharing insights into the region's ecosystem, culture, and history.
